What are the three sources that contain the basic disciplinary laws of the US Navy?
|
-US Navy Regulations
-Standard Organization and Regulations of the US Navy -Uniform Code of Military Justice |
|
Under article V of the code of conduct, what is the only information you are allowed to give if taken as a POW?
|
Name, rank, service number, and date of birth
|
|
What theory of punishment is used by the Navy?
|
Deterrent
|
|
Who issues and makes changes to the Navy Regs, and who approves them?
|
Issued by the Secretary of the Navy, approved by the President
|
|
What chapter of the Navy Regs deals with your rights and responsibilities?
|
Chapter 11
|
|
What UCMJ article states that certain articles of the code must be explained to every enlisted person at the time of entrance or no later than 6 days later, 6 months on active duty, and every reenlistment?
|
Article 137
|
|
What are the three types of courts-martial?
|
Summary
Special General |
|
Who is responsible for making sure the Navy Regs conform to the current needs of the Department of the Navy?
|
Chief of Naval Operations
|
|
How many articles are in the Code of Conduct?
|
Six
|
|
Articles 77 through 134 of the UCMJ are referred to as what type of articles?
|
Punitive
|
